About Pace-Stancil Funeral Home & Cemetery
Since 1938, Pace-Stancil Funeral Home & Cemetery has been synonymous with caring and compassionate personalized funeral care. Centrally located on Crockett Street in Cleveland, Texas, they are proud of their deep-rooted history and remain steadfast in their commitment to the families they serve. They are a nondenominational funeral home, welcoming families of all backgrounds and traditions from in and around Liberty County as well as Chambers, Harris, Hardin and Montgomery County including Cleveland, Tarkington, Splendora, Dayton, Coldspring, Liberty, Shepherd, New Caney, Porter, Conroe and beyond.
